The Transformation Through Autonomous Autos

Independent automobiles are set to redefine logistics by improving the speed, efficiency, and cost-effectiveness of transporting items. Self-driving vehicles can operate around the clock without the demand for remainder, considerably reducing distribution times. Drones, on the other hand, deal fast delivery solutions, specifically beneficial in metropolitan areas for last-mile distribution.

Advantages of Autonomous Automobiles in Logistics

1. Cost Financial savings: Self-governing vehicles can drastically reduce labor expenses, which constitute a huge part of logistics expenses. With fewer vehicle drivers required, companies can reduce wages, benefits, and training costs. In addition, the capability to operate lorries continually without breaks causes a lot more efficient property use.
2. Enhanced Performance: Self-driving cars have the capacity to effectively intend and change courses on-the-go to prevent traffic jams and minimize fuel. This leads to decreased functional expenses and much less harm to the setting. Drones provide a rapid and effective distribution service by flying over roadway congestion.
3. Enhanced Safety and security: In the logistics market, crashes frequently take place due to human blunders. Autonomous automobiles, which are equipped with sophisticated technology like sensors and AI, have the possible to lower the probability of accidents. By preserving steady speeds, adhering to traffic guidelines rigorously, and responding without delay to dangers, independent vehicles can improve safety and security considerably contrasted to human drivers.
4. Scalability is considerably boosted in logistics operations with using independent vehicles. Services have the adaptability to grow their transport abilities without being restricted by labor force restraints, which is especially helpful throughout busy durations of high need.

Challenges Dealing With Autonomous Autos in Logistics

1. Difficulties in Regulations: The guidelines regulating independent vehicles are constantly altering. Numerous countries and areas have various lawful requirements, making it challenging for services that function across borders. Satisfying the criteria and receiving authorization for self-governing features can take a substantial amount of time and money.
2. Safety and security Concerns: In spite of the capacity for boosted safety and security, autonomous cars are not totally supreme. The threat of mechanical failures, hacking, and unexpected risks stays a substantial problem. To guarantee the dependability and safety and security of these systems, complete screening and durable cybersecurity protocols are important.
3. Technological Limitations: The modern technology behind independent vehicles, though advanced, is not yet ideal. Sensors can be impacted by negative climate condition, and intricate urban settings pose navigation difficulties. Constant enhancement and advancement are essential to resolve these limitations.
4. Public Acceptance: The acceptance of autonomous vehicles by the public and by industry professionals is a significant barrier. Issues about task losses, security, and the dependability of these systems need to be dealt with with transparent communication, education, and presentation of the benefits and dependability of self-governing innovation.
